dc.description.abstract This study aimed at evaluating the Electronic Government in Algeria from the Public Administration employees’ viewpoint by using their opinions about the extent of providing the necessary requirements for the success of the electronic government and its goals, The field study took place in the services in charge of producing the biometric ID cards and passports in the “Daïras” (Districts) and the Municipalities of Wilaya of Ouargla. The sample of study is made of 175 employees in the services, and to reach the aims of this study we used a questionnaire as the main tool of our survey. In addition, we used mean, the standard deviation, Relative Importance Index, Independent Samples Test, One way ANOVA, and Tukey test for dimensional comparisons, to accomplish the study’s aims. After the statistical analysis and according to the employees, we found that the extent of providing the requirements of the success of the electronic government is medium; meanwhile they expressed a positive view towards reaching the aims of the electronic government in Algeria. Accordingly, the results showed that there were differences of statistical significance in the requirements of the success of the electronic government in Algeria due to the age and the nature of the job, and not to the gender, the level of education, the seniority, or the job itself.
